Zvládnutí konverze EPS do TEXu pomocí GroupDocs.Conversion pro .NET

Zavedení

Při práci s formáty dokumentů může být převod souboru Encapsulated PostScript (EPS) do zdrojového dokumentu LaTeX (TEX) klíčový pro začlenění vysoce kvalitní grafiky do akademických prací nebo technické dokumentace. GroupDocs.Conversion pro .NET, můžete snadno převést soubory EPS do formátu TEX, čímž zefektivníte svůj pracovní postup s dokumenty.

V tomto tutoriálu si projdeme procesem použití GroupDocs.Conversion k transformaci souborů EPS do formátu TEX. Na konci budete dobře vybaveni pro snadnou správu podobných konverzí.

Co se naučíte:

  • Nastavení a používání GroupDocs.Conversion pro .NET
  • Postupný převod z formátu EPS do formátu TEX
  • Optimalizace výkonu pro zpracování velkých dokumentů
  • Praktické aplikace této konverze v reálných scénářích

Začněme tím, že si probereme předpoklady.

Předpoklady

Než začnete, ujistěte se, že máte nastavené potřebné knihovny a prostředí:

  • GroupDocs.Conversion pro .NET knihovna (verze 25.3.0)
  • Vývojové prostředí s .NET Framework nebo .NET Core
  • Základní znalost programování v C#

Po splnění těchto předpokladů pojďme k nastavení GroupDocs.Conversion pro .NET.

Nastavení GroupDocs.Conversion pro .NET

Chcete-li začít, nainstalujte si knihovnu GroupDocs.Conversion pomocí správce balíčků:

Konzola Správce balíčků N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

Rozhraní příkazového řádku .NET

dotnet add package GroupDocs.Conversion --version 25.3.0

Získání licence

GroupDocs nabízí bezplatnou zkušební verzi, dočasné licence a možnosti zakoupení. Začněte s bezplatná zkušební verze k vyhodnocení možností knihovny. Pro delší používání zvažte pořízení dočasné licence nebo její zakoupení od jejich stránka nákupu.

Základní inicializace a nastavení

Po instalaci inicializujte GroupDocs.Conversion ve vašem projektu C#:

using GroupDocs.Conversion;

Toto nastavení vás připraví na zahájení převodu souborů.

Průvodce implementací

Jakmile je vše nastaveno, pojďme si projít kroky pro převod souboru EPS do formátu TEX pomocí GroupDocs.Conversion.

Převod souboru EPS do formátu TEX

Přehled

Tato funkce umožňuje transformaci souboru Encapsulated PostScript (EPS) do zdrojového dokumentu LaTeX (TEX), což je ideální pro dokumenty vyžadující vysoce kvalitní grafickou integraci.

Postupná implementace

1. Definování cest pro vstup a výstup Začněte zadáním cesty k vstupnímu souboru EPS a výstupnímu adresáři:

string sampleEpsP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.eps"); // Nahraďte skutečnou cestou k souboru EPS.
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; // Zástupný symbol pro výstupní adresář.
string outputFile = Path.Combine(outputFolder, "eps-converted-to.tex");

2. Načtěte zdrojový soubor EPS Načtěte soubor EPS pomocí GroupDocs.Conversion:

using (var converter = new GroupDocs.Conversion.Converter(sampleEpsPath))
{
    // Zde bude definován proces konverze.
}

Toto inicializuje Converter objekt s vámi zadaným EPS souborem.

3. Nastavení možností konverze Definujte možnosti převodu pro specifikaci formátu TEX:

P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ions { Format = GroupDocs.Conversion.FileTypes.PageDescriptionLanguageFileType.Tex };

Zde, PageDescriptionLanguageConvertOptions je nakonfigurován pro TEX výstup.

4. Proveďte konverzi Spusťte a uložte konverzi:

converter.Convert(outputFile, options);

Tento řádek provede skutečný převod EPS do TEXu a uloží jej do zadaného adresáře.

Tipy pro řešení problémů

  • Ujistěte se, že je vstupní cesta EPS správná.
  • Ověřte existenci výstupního adresáře nebo jej v případě potřeby vytvořte.
  • Pro správu chyb během převodu použijte blok try-catch.

Praktické aplikace

Převod souborů EPS do formátu TEX slouží několika praktickým účelům:

  1. Akademický výzkumBezproblémová integrace vysoce kvalitní grafiky do akademických prací.
  2. Technická dokumentaceVylepšete manuály podrobnými grafickými ilustracemi.
  3. Vydavatelský průmyslPřipravovat složité dokumenty k publikaci a zajistit kvalitu textu i vizuálních prvků.

Tyto případy použití zdůrazňují všestrannost GroupDocs.Conversion v profesionálním prostředí.

Úvahy o výkonu

Pro velké soubory EPS nebo více konverzí:

  • Optimalizujte využití zdrojů efektivní správou paměti v rámci vašich .NET aplikací.
  • Používejte asynchronní metody ke zlepšení odezvy aplikací.
  • Dodržujte osvědčené postupy pro zpracování operací I/O pro zvýšení výkonu.

Závěr

V tomto tutoriálu jste se naučili, jak převést soubor EPS do formátu TEX pomocí nástroje GroupDocs.Conversion pro .NET. Probrali jste nastavení knihovny, implementaci procesu převodu a prozkoumali praktické aplikace této funkce. Jako další kroky zvažte experimentování s dalšími formáty, které GroupDocs.Conversion podporuje.

Implementujte tato řešení ve svých projektech ještě dnes!

Sekce Často kladených otázek

1. Jak mohu řešit chyby během převodu EPS do TEX?

  • Ujistěte se, že všechny cesty jsou správně definovány.
  • Zkontrolujte dostatečná oprávnění ke vstupním/výstupním adresářům.
  • Zpracování výjimek pro zachycení problémů, které vzniknou během převodu.

2. Může GroupDocs.Conversion zvládat dávkové zpracování více souborů?

  • Ano, můžete procházet adresářem a převádět každý soubor jednotlivě pomocí podobných struktur kódu.

3. Je možné tuto konverzi integrovat do webových aplikací?

  • Rozhodně! Můžete použít GroupDocs.Conversion v rámci ASP.NET projektů pro konverze na straně serveru.

4. Jaké další formáty mohu převést pomocí GroupDocs.Conversion?

  • GroupDocs.Conversion podporuje širokou škálu formátů dokumentů, včetně PDF, Wordu, Excelu a dalších.

5. Jak optimalizuji výkon konverze velkých souborů?

  • Implementujte asynchronní metody a efektivně spravujte využití paměti pro efektivní zpracování větších dokumentů.

Zdroje

Pro další zkoumání a podporu: